Weight Watchers Bread Availability at Walmart
While some shoppers in Canada report finding Weight Watchers (WW) branded bread products, such as WW™ White Sliced Bread and WW™ 100% Whole Wheat Loaf, at their local Walmart, this is not a consistent experience for everyone. In many US Walmart stores, shoppers will more likely encounter a variety of other low-point options rather than the specific WW branded loaf. This is due to regional distribution agreements and inventory management that differ from country to country and even store to store.
Where to Find Low-Point Bread in Walmart
If the official WW bread is not on the shelves, several other locations within the store can yield excellent, WW-friendly alternatives:
- The Bakery Aisle: This is the most common place to find standard and thin-sliced bread options. Look for brands that offer low-calorie or high-fiber choices. Check the nutritional information closely, as points can vary significantly between brands and loaf sizes.
- The Freezer Section: Specialized bread, such as Ezekiel 4:9 Sprouted Whole Grain Bread, is often found in the freezer aisle. These loaves are known for being dense, nutrient-rich, and often low in points, making them a popular choice for many WW members.
- The Diet/Health Food Aisle: Some stores group health-conscious products together. This area may contain low-carb, keto-friendly, or gluten-free breads, such as those from Lewis Bake Shop Healthy Life or Canyon Bakehouse.
Popular Low-Point Bread Alternatives at Walmart
When official WW bread isn't an option, members turn to other reliable products. These alternatives are widely available and can easily fit into the WW program.
Great Value Brand Bread
Walmart's own Great Value brand offers several budget-friendly options that work for WW members. Several varieties, like the 100% Whole Wheat, are known to be a low-point choice. Always verify the specific points using the WW app, as product formulations and points values can change.
Lewis Bake Shop Healthy Life Bread
Often cited in WW-related forums, the Lewis Bake Shop Healthy Life line is a favorite for its low-calorie content. The bread is typically available in white, whole wheat, and keto-friendly versions. A Reddit post highlighted the 35-calorie per slice bread, which is an excellent option for those tracking points closely.
Dave's Killer Bread Thin-Sliced
For those who prefer organic, high-protein, and high-fiber bread, Dave's Killer Bread is a fantastic option. While potentially higher in points per slice than ultra-low-calorie alternatives, the thin-sliced varieties offer better portion control and more nutritional density.

Smart Shopping Tips for WW at Walmart
- Use the WW App: Always scan the product's barcode with the official WW app to get the most accurate and up-to-date points value. Nutritional information can change, and points are assigned based on the specific macro-nutrient profile.
- Read the Labels: If you can't scan, look for low-calorie, high-fiber, and whole-grain options. High fiber content helps lower the net carbs and, subsequently, the points value.
- Check Multiple Sections: As mentioned, don't limit yourself to just the main bread aisle. Look in the freezer and diet food sections for more specialty options that may fit your plan better.
- Consider Other Breads: Expand your search beyond sliced loaves. Low-point wraps like Joseph's lavash bread or pita bread are frequently found at Walmart and offer great versatility.
- Look for Sales: Generic store-brand alternatives are often cheaper than branded health foods. Walmart's Great Value line provides a consistently low-cost, low-point option.
